  3. clyde s says:

    Laminate usually runs around $5 a square foot installed, but such a small job, you may get charged a minimum charge. Typically around 125 in labor, unless you find a small store that does all the work in house. Carpet you can figure about 2.20 a sq. ft installed with pad. You may run into the same thing, with the minimum charge. You do know that your homeowners insurance will cover this, right? clyde s
